What is the percentage decrease of y=320(0.665)^x

Answers

Answer:

33.5%

Step-by-step explanation:

The general form of an exponential equation showing decay is;

A = I(1-r)^t

The percentage part is 1-r

Equate this to what we have in the question

1-r = 0.665

r = 1-0.665

r = 0.335

This in percentage is 33.5%

Olivia picked 256 strawberries from the orchards fields. she divided the strawberries evenly into 6 baskets. how many strawberries are in each basket? how many are left over?

Answers

Answer:

42 strawberries are in each basket. 4 strawberries are left over.

Step-by-step explanation:

To find out how many she put into each basket, you need to divide 256/6. Your answer should 42.6666667. Round down to 42.

To find out how many are left over, multiply 42 x 6. You need to do this to figure out how many strawberries total she used trying to put them evenly into the baskets. Your answer should be 252. Then, you subtract 256 - 252. You do this to find out how many are left over. Your answer is 4.

different question: You and your friend skate at the same rate. You complete 6 laps in 5 minutes. How long does your friend take to complete 18 laps?

Answers

Answer: 15 minutes

Step-by-step explanation:

Since we skate at same rate and I complete 6 laps in 5 minutes. The number of minutes that my friend will take to complete 18 laps would be calculated as:

= 18 ÷ 6/5

= 18 × 5/6

= 3 × 5

= 15 minutes
